A well-hidden gem of a campground, Kenneth Grove flies below the radar and frequently has vacancies both on weekdays and weekends. Some campsites include full hookups, some have partial hookups (electric & water), and some are for dry camping. Of note, most (if not all) of the sites do not have fire rings, so campers are required to bring their own (e.g. BioLite, Solo Stove). They have also begun upgrading some of the signage and trash/recycling bins at the park, which is welcome.I’ve found the campground to be very quiet during the week, but has a tendency to attract louder groups on the weekends. (We were here when the police had to respond to a particularly loud/drunk group a couple months ago. Not to mention that groups shouldn’t be camping together right now anyway.)Of note, we have found that site 18 is a cute and cozy corner location, but seemed overrun with tiny green spiders when we stayed there. In any case, Kenney Grove is certainly a good find, but be aware of the caveats.

I absolutely loved this little campground. I was vacationing on a tight budget and was very pleased with the affordability of this place. Even though it’s relatively small in size, every campground has trees around it and a picnic table with a natural stone ring as a fire pit. They also feature first come, first serve; which I love. This place has decent cinderblock showers that you pay using quarters (don’t worry, you only need as little as 2 for 4 minutes, 3 for 6, and so on). Also for those of you who have kids, there is plenty of grass space for them to run around, along with a full set of playground equipment like swings, a merry-go-round, and slides. I’m 100% coming back here.
